Audit checklist item 14: Spreadsheet export memory usage in Ledgerloom. Verify that exports over 50,000 rows stream to disk rather than buffering the full workbook in memory. Support has logged three out-of-memory incidents this quarter, all traced to the legacy exporter path. Confirm the streaming exporter is enabled on all production pods and that the legacy flag is removed. Record peak memory during a test export. Responsibility for completing this item rests with the individual named below.

account owner for fajep-yagef: Kasix Eliiel

# Basement Archive Room — Night Access

The archive room under Pellworth House holds old contracts and the tape backups. Night shift: take stairwell C, not the lift (it's switched off after midnight). Lights are on a timer by the door — slap the button as you go in. Sign the logbook, even at 3am, yes really. The keypad by the door takes the code below.

staff pass of fahap-tajeg = bdg-FT-6

**14:22 — Compression rollback decision.** We confirmed that enabling permessage-deflate on Wrenpipe's websocket gateway cut bandwidth 38% but pushed p99 CPU past the throttle threshold on the smaller nodes, causing the 14:05 disconnect wave. We disabled compression for payloads under 2 KB and kept it for larger frames. Reviewer: the relevant diff is the threshold constant only. The deploy that carried the fix is recorded below.

trace token, fafog-kageg: htk4_98e6

# Build Provenance: EXIF Scrubbing

All images processed through the Lanternfold pipeline are stripped of EXIF metadata before publication. Plugin authors must not reintroduce metadata in post-processing hooks; the provenance checker will reject such artifacts. Scrubbing occurs at the ingest stage, so thumbnails and derivatives inherit clean headers automatically. Each published artifact carries a provenance record, and the token for the current pipeline build appears below.

pipeline stamp: htk31_f769b577b3028a4e9958e5bb8d1259a